A bill for an act
relating to liquor; allowing licensed manufacturer of wine to sell hard cider at
on-sale or off-sale without Minnesota grown requirement; amending Minnesota
Statutes 2018, sections 340A.101, by adding a subdivision; 340A.301, subdivision
10.

B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F MINNESOTA:

Section 1.

Minnesota Statutes 2018, section 340A.101, is amended by adding a subdivision
to read:


new text begin Subd. 12b. new text end

new text begin Hard cider. new text end

new text begin "Hard cider" means a beverage that may contain carbonation
and flavors, produced through alcoholic fermentation of any fruit or fruit juice, consisting
of at least one-half percent but not greater than seven percent alcohol by volume and sold
or offered for sale as hard cider and not as a wine, wine product, or substitute for wine in
bottles, cases, kegs, cans, or other suitable containers of the type used for the sale of malt
liquor in this state.

Sec. 2.

Minnesota Statutes 2018, section 340A.301, subdivision 10, is amended to read:


Subd. 10.

Sales without license.

new text begin (a) new text end A licensed brewer or brew pub may without an
additional license sell malt liquor to employees or retired former employees, in amounts of
not more than 768 fluid ounces in a week for off-premise consumption only.

new text begin (b)new text end A collector of commemorative bottles, those terms are as defined in section 297G.01,
subdivisions 4 and 5, may sell them to another collector without a license. It is also lawful
for a collector of beer cans to sell unopened cans of a brand which has not been sold
commercially for at least two years to another collector without obtaining a license. The
amount sold to any one collector in any one month shall not exceed 768 fluid ounces.

new text begin (c)new text end A licensed manufacturer of wine containing not more than 25 percent alcohol by
volume nor less than 51 percent wine made from Minnesota-grown agricultural products
may sell at on-sale or off-sale wine made on the licensed premises without a further license.

new text begin (d) Notwithstanding paragraph (c), a licensed manufacturer of wine may sell at on-sale
or off-sale hard cider made on the licensed premises without a further license and without
a Minnesota grown agricultural product requirement.
